The 2012 to 2016 Olympic cycle saw Italy as the most dominant team. At London 2012, France could not medal, Russia could not medal, China could not medal, USA could not medal. All that could "compete" with Italy were Japan and Germany - and even then, their chance of victory was not even close to 50/50. Since the 2012 Olympics, Team USA finally became a big player, with Miles Chamley-Watson winning the 2013 Individual World Championships, Race Imboden becoming World Number 1 in the Season of 2014-15, and Alexander Massialas and Gerek Meinhardt both medalling at the 2015 Individual World Championships, while the former also won Silver at the Rio Olympics and was World Number 1 in the Seasons of 2015-16 and 2016-17.

While Team USA was rising in the lead up to the Rio Olympics Team Italy had been mellowing. While Garozzo joining the team in 2015 and Italy went into Rio as the reigning World Champions, it was clear that they were not the at the same strength as in 2012. Cassara was getting less reliable, Garozzo has only been on the team for one season, Aspromonte got bored, Avola just isn't a replacement for Cassara or Baldini, and Baldini's style just was no longer viable in the new march-based foil meta.

Team USA beat Italy at the Rio Olympics Bronze Medal match, but after Rio, Massialas focused on his studies, while Meinhardt wrestled with retirement. In Italy, Baldini retired and Garozzo took the anchor spot. Foconi also joined the team, which was a much needed addition. These new line-ups saw the two teams clash on partial strengths a few times in the season. Now it's the World Championships and the two teams are at full strengths to fight for who will be the most dominant team for the next Olympic cycle.

Their match-ups in this season:
Tokyo 2016 - USA 45 - 34 Italy
Paris 2017 - USA 44 - 45 Italy
Bonn 2017 - USA 20 - 40 Italy (Without Massialas) Team USA conceded after the 8th leg as both Meinhardt and Chamley-Watson were injured so there was no one to fence the final leg.
